Grace patricia kelly november 12, 1929 september 14, 1982 was an american film actress who, after starring in several significant films in the early to mid1950s, became princess of monaco by marrying prince rainier iii in april 1956. Her girlhood was uneventful for the most part, but one of the things she desired was to become an actress which she had decided on at an early age.

She won an oscar for her performance in the country girl but was perhaps better known for her films with alfred hitchcock, including rear window and to catch a thief. Grace kelly also known as the grace kelly story is a 1983 american madefortelevision biographical film starring cheryl ladd as grace kelly, princess of monaco. Grace kelly november 12, 1929 september 14, 1982 was an american actress who made her debut on television in the play old lady robbins 1948 on the anthology series, kraft television theatre.
